Pharmacy support in developing prescribing skills.

Andrew McGuire1, Tom McEwan2, Deborah Stafford2

  • 1Clinical Skills Centre, University of Dundee, Ninewells Hospital & Medical School, Dundee, UK.

The Clinical Teacher
|June 16, 2015
PubMed
Summary
This summary is machine-generated.

Pharmacists enhance medical education by designing objective structured clinical examinations (OSCEs) to improve safe prescribing skills for junior doctors. This approach boosts confidence and awareness of potential prescribing errors.

Area of Science:

  • Medical Education
  • Pharmacology
  • Patient Safety

Background:

  • Prescribing errors are common and impact many patients, with gaps in medical training contributing to these issues.
  • Traditional apprenticeship models for prescribing skills are insufficient given complex healthcare and polypharmacy.
  • Pharmacists play a crucial role in educating and practicing safe prescribing.

Purpose of the Study:

  • To evaluate an objective structured clinical examination (OSCE) format for teaching safe prescribing to medical students.
  • To assess the impact of pharmacist-led simulation sessions on prescribing awareness and confidence.

Main Methods:

  • Final-year medical students participated in simulated ward scenarios using an OSCE format.
  • Scenarios focused on common prescribing errors, with pharmacist feedback integrated into tasks.
  • Students rehearsed six distinct prescribing situations.

Main Results:

  • The OSCE approach enhanced students' awareness of prescribing errors.
  • Students reported increased confidence in their prescribing abilities.
  • Pharmacist involvement was identified as a key factor in learning.

Conclusions:

  • Pharmacist-designed and facilitated OSCEs offer significant benefits for student learning in accurate prescribing.
  • This educational intervention improves junior doctors' preparedness for safe medication management.
  • Integrating pharmacists into medical training enhances patient safety through improved prescribing practices.
